The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Social Skills in contract job vacancies in London.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Social Skills over the 6 months leading up to 8 August 2026,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
8 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 2 2 3
Rank change year-on-year 0 +1 0
Contract jobs citing Social Skills 4,460 3,933 3,473
As % of all contract jobs in London 21.99% 28.97% 21.42%
As % of the General category 36.20% 42.26% 34.27%
Number of daily rates quoted 2,787 2,575 2,340
10th Percentile £308 £300 £287
25th Percentile £419 £408 £413
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£525 £525 £538
Median % change year-on-year - -2.33% -5.70%
75th Percentile £650 £675 £663
90th Percentile £750 £775 £775
England median daily rate £506 £500 £513
% change year-on-year +1.20% -2.44% -2.38%
Number of hourly rates quoted 99 74 69
10th Percentile £15.91 £15.84 £16.45
25th Percentile £18.75 £20.24 £20.75
Median hourly rate £24.00 £33.25 £37.50
Median % change year-on-year -27.82% -11.33% +0.67%
75th Percentile £41.00 £45.75 £51.75
90th Percentile £59.35 £55.25 £65.63
England median hourly rate £22.81 £22.05 £27.24
% change year-on-year +3.45% -19.04% +36.18%
